There are a few things on each review I do and don't agree with:

- I don't think that the movie sucks because it is a little bit like other movies. There was enough of a story around the general concept that made it not a 'cookie cutter' Ferngully clone.
- The computer animation is the best of all time. It is so much better than in Lord of the Rings and King Kong.
- The Colonel is a great villain and a dammed cool character. He really is great.
- I think that the movie is more anti-military than anti-white. There were blacks asians and latins who were killing the Na'Vi not just the white people. The company is just as evil and also stupid. So the company hires scientists and pays them lots of money for reasearch and for advice, and when the scientists say not to destroy the big spirit trees the company weasel and Colonel don't listen to them? The film is supposed to make the military and corporations look evil and make the hippy scientists be the good guys.

You two said that the last battle is awesome and I agree 120%. But I can't believe that Ritos didn't dig into 'bows and arrows blowing up tanks'. That part was BS.

I SAW AVATAR LAST NIGHT. It was actually better than I expected, but it wasn't a great movie. Honestly, the movie 'Wall-E' had a bigger impact on me than 'Avatar', not just in graphics but in the message of the story. Wall-E was about human consumption and where it may lead us, and it was also a really interesting semi-silent movie. Avatar was too preachy with the 'evil humans' thing for me to take seriously. The action was pretty good, and the CGI was impressive.
